Ranunculus asiaticus
- Common name(s): Persian Buttercup
- Blooming time: spring to early summer
- Blooming colors: yellow, orange, red, pink, white, multicolored
- Height: 20 to 30 cm
- Origin: Greece, West Asia, Northern Africa
- Hardiness zone (USDA): Z9 – up to -4 °C
- Family: Ranunculaceae
- More infos: all parts of the plant are poisonous
